`I am Chairman of Gelber Group, LLC, located at 141 W. Jackson, 21st Floor,
`2.
`Chicago, IL 60604. Gelber Group has been a Full Clearing Member of the Chicago
`Board ofTrade ("CBOT") and the Chicago Mercantile Exchange ("CME") since 1989.
`Gelber Group is also a Full Clearing Member of OneChicago and NQLX and an
`Exchange Member ofEurex, LIFFE Connect and Matif. Gelber Group accounts for
`approximately 5-10% of the total electronic volume traded on the CBOT and the CME.
`
`I have over 25 years experience in the trading world. I started my career as a
`3.
`broker in 1977 on the T -bond floor of the CBOT. In 1979, I began trading for my own
`account on the floor. From 1979 to 1985, I was one ofthe largest brokers and local
`traders ofT-bond futures at the CBOT. In 1986, I left the floor. Gelber Group first
`started trading interactively by computer in 1998.
`
`In 1999, Gelber Group chose Patsystems as its primary vendor for electronic
`4.
`trading software. This decision was based primarily on cost.
`
`After TT launched MD Trader, TT became Gelber Group's primary vendor. The
`5.
`decision to switch was based primarily on the fact that Gelber Group's traders found TT's
`product, and in particular the MD Trader tool, to be a premium product offering more
`information for those who interactively traded as compared to the competition. Gelber
`Group made this switch despite the fact that TT's software was more expensive than the
`Patsystems software. I recall that some of the reasons why Gelber Group's traders liked
`MD Trader had to do with an improved visual appearance in which it was easy to see
`movements in the market and with other functionality of the tool.
